About Min Li
Min Li is a scholar working on Molecular Biology, Computational Theory and Mathematics, Artificial Intelligence, Cancer Research and Materials Chemistry, having authored 514 papers that have together received 11.5k indexed citations. Recurring topics across this work include Bioinformatics and Genomic Networks (114 papers), Computational Drug Discovery Methods (89 papers), Machine Learning in Bioinformatics (69 papers), Protein Structure and Dynamics (40 papers), Gene expression and cancer classification (36 papers), RNA and protein synthesis mechanisms (26 papers), Single-cell and spatial transcriptomics (26 papers) and Cancer-related molecular mechanisms research (22 papers). The work is most often cited by research in Computational Theory and Mathematics (2.6k citations), Molecular Biology (7.0k citations), Cancer Research (1.3k citations), Health Information Management (197 citations) and Neurology (241 citations). Min Li has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Jianxin Wang, Yi Pan, Fang‐Xiang Wu, Yaohang Li, Min Zeng, Yu Tang, Ruiqing Zheng, Chengqian Lu, Fuhao Zhang and Wei Lan. Their work appears in journals such as IEEE/ACM Transactions on Computational Biology and Bioinformatics, Bioinformatics, Briefings in Bioinformatics, Methods and BMC Bioinformatics.
